Today, Congressman Bill Huizenga (MI-02) released the following statement after voting in support of legislation to make Juneteenth a federal holiday.

"Officially recognizing Juneteenth as a federal holiday helps commemorate the historical significance of the end of slavery," said Congressman Bill Huizenga. "Making Juneteenth a federal holiday is absolutely the right thing to do and I proudly cast this vote."
